The new species Inocybe quercicola is described on the basis of morphological and genetic features. It characterized by medium-sized basidiomata, radially fibrillose campanulate pileus, dark brown lamellae when mature, stipe that pruinose along whole length, nodulose, rather small basidiospores (av. 8.8×5.5 μm, Qav.=1.53) pleurocystidia which are similar to cheilocystidia in shape but smaller size (19–22 × 47–65 μm).
